LES PRINCIPALES COMMANDES CONSOLE
Vous retrouverez ci‐dessous une liste des principales
commandes qui permettent de contrôler l'équipement :
METTRE A JOUR LE FIRMWARE
Pour cela il est impératif que le WiFi de l'AVIOR soit correctement paramétré pour lui permettre un accès à internet et
au Cloud du constructeur pour aller chercher son nouveau Firmware.
Command
AT#OTA=<code>
Response
OK
COMMAND ACCEPTED
ERROR
COMMAND REJECTED
Parameters
<code>
N° de CODE de la version du Firmware, exemple 2.06, soit :
AT#OTA=2.06
ETEINDRE L'APPAREIL
Éteint l'appareil, qui restera alimenté jusqu'à ce que les sources d'alimentation externes soient retirées, après quoi
chaque périphérique sera déconnecté (y compris l'horloge de bord), la consommation d'énergie sera réduite à zéro.
Command
AT#OFF
Response
OK
COMMAND ACCEPTED
ERROR
COMMAND REJECTED
FORCER BIT ET SORTIES RELAIS
Bien qu'il soit possible de contrôler les sorties et les bits de mémoire en modifiant les paramètres du fichier de
mappage, une commande spécifique permet de définir l'état et la durée de libération optionnelle.
Command
<id>=<cmd>[,<time>]
Response
OK
ERROR
Parameters
<id>
<cmd>
<time>
Le nom par défaut et le nom attribué peuvent être utilisés comme identifiant. Par exemple, le nom par défaut pour la
sortie 1 est out1 et le nom de la lampe peut avoir été attribué, puis out1 = 1 ou lamp = 1 sont équivalents.
<heure> est facultatif et ignoré pour les commandes de réinitialisation et de basculement.
PAUSE
Suspend l'exécution des commandes. En omettant le temps de pause, force la fin de toute pause en cours et reprend
immédiatement l'exécution des commandes.
Command
AT#WAIT[=<time>]
Response
OK
ERROR
Parameters
<time>
Utile dans les règles ou dans l'exécution de commandes concaténées:
out1 = 1 à # wait = 5 out2 = 1
dans cette séquence, la sortie 2 est activée 5 secondes après la sortie 1
TRANSMISSION INFRAROUGE
Émet un code infrarouge de l'émetteur situé à l'avant de l'appareil à l'aide du protocole spécifié.
Command
AT#IRTX=<protocol>,<address>,<code>
Response
OK
ERROR
Parameters
<protocol>
<address>
<code>
Chaque appareil récepteur possède son propre ensemble de codes et de fonctions associées. Le code à envoyer doit
être identifié en consultant la documentation de l'équipement à contrôler.
EMETTRE UNE SONNERIE SUR LE BUZZER
Joue la tonalité souhaitée sur le haut‐parleur interne de l'appareil.
Command
AT#SPK=<tone>
Response
OK
ERROR
Parameters
<tone>
FORCER LA MISE A JOUR DE L'HORLOGE
Forcer la mise à jour de l'horloge en temps réel, en se connectant au service réseau.
Command
AT#TIME
Response
OK
ERROR
La liste complète des instructions et autres
paramètres de configuration est disponible à
l'adresse : https://www.contrive.mobi/avior/en/
COMMAND ACCEPTED
COMMAND REJECTED
OUTPUT NAME AS DEFINED IN TAG Ox1
MEMORY BIT NAME AS DEFINED IN TAG Mx0
0 or off : RESET OUTPUT OR MEMORY BIT
1 or on : SET OUTPUT OR MEMORY BIT
T : TOGGLE CURRENT STATUS
0001 ... 3600 : Seconde(s) ou
YYMMDDhhmm : Date d'exécution
Exemple : OUT1=1
COMMAND ACCEPTED
COMMAND REJECTED
1...9 : SECONDS
COMMAND ACCEPTED
COMMAND REJECTED
ENCODING PROTOCOL TO BE USED
RC5 RC6 NEC SONY SHARP PANASONIC
ADDRESS OF TARGET DEVICE
0...127
CODE TO BE TRANSMITTED
0...127
COMMAND ACCEPTED
COMMAND REJECTED
TONE TO BE PLAYED
1 : 700 Hz 4 seconds
2 : 800 Hz 4 seconds
3 : 900 Hz 4 seconds
4 : 1000 Hz 4 seconds
5 : 1100 Hz 4 seconds
6 : 1200 Hz 4 seconds
7 : 1300 Hz 4 seconds
8 : 1400 Hz 4 seconds
COMMAND ACCEPTED
COMMAND REJECTED
FORCER MISE A JOUR DE LA GEOLOCALISATION
Forcer la mise à jour de la position géographique, extraite des informations actuelles fournies par le réseau.
Command
AT#GEO
Response
OK
ERROR
FORCER LA CONNEXION AU SERVEUR CLOUD
Forcer la connexion immédiate au compte cloud, en ignorant les paramètres actuels.
Les informations en attente seront envoyées (le cas échéant) et les commandes en attente seront téléchargées (le cas
échéant).
Command
AT#CON
Response
OK
ERROR
FORCER LA CHARGE DE LA BATTERIE
Forcez le chargement de la batterie, sans tenir compte de la gestion de la batterie.
C'est une condition temporaire: la gestion de la batterie prendra le contrôle au moins 60 secondes plus tard.
Command
AT#CHRG[=<status>]
Response
OK
ERROR
Parameters
<status>
COMMAND ACCEPTED
COMMAND REJECTED
COMMAND ACCEPTED
COMMAND REJECTED
COMMAND ACCEPTED
COMMAND REJECTED
0 : TURN OFF CHARGE
1 : TURN ON CHARGE